diff --git a/tests/js/tsourcemap.nim b/tests/js/tsourcemap.nim new file mode 100644 index 000000000..ff6f6122f --- /dev/null +++ b/tests/js/tsourcemap.nim @@ -0,0 +1,96 @@ +discard """ + action: "run" + target: "js" + cmd: "nim js -r -d:nodejs $options --sourceMap:on $file" +""" +import std/[os, json, strutils, sequtils, algorithm, assertions, paths, compilesettings] + +# Implements a very basic sourcemap parser and then runs it on itself. +# Allows to check for basic problems such as bad counts and lines missing (e.g. issue #21052) + +type + SourceMap = object + version: int + sources: seq[string] + names: seq[string] + mappings: string + file: string + + Line = object + line, column: int + file: string + +const + flag = 1 shl 5 + signBit = 0b1 + fourBits = 0b1111 + fiveBits = 0b11111 + mask = (1 shl 5) - 1 + alphabet = "ABCDEFGHIJKLMNOPQRSTUVWXYZabcdefghijklmnopqrstuvwxyz0123456789+/" + +var b64Table: seq[int] = 0.repeat(max(alphabet.mapIt(it.ord)) + 1) +for i, b in alphabet.pairs: + b64Table[b.ord] = i + +# From https://github.com/juancarlospaco/nodejs/blob/main/src/nodejs/jsfs.nim +proc importFs*() {.importjs: "var fs = require(\"fs\");".} +proc readFileSync*(path: cstring): cstring {.importjs: "(fs.$1(#).toString())".} +importFS() +# Read in needed files +let + jsFileName = string(querySetting(outDir).Path / "tsourcemap.js".Path) + mapFileName = jsFileName & ".map" + + data = parseJson($mapFileName.cstring.readFileSync()).to(SourceMap) + jsFile = $readFileSync(jsFileName.cstring) + +proc decodeVLQ(inp: string): seq[int] = + var + shift, value: int + for v in inp.mapIt(b64Table[it.ord]): + value += (v and mask) shl shift + if (v and flag) > 0: + shift += 5 + continue + result &= (value shr 1) * (if (value and 1) > 0: -1 else: 1) + shift = 0 + value = 0 + + +# Keep track of state +var + line = 0 + source = 0 + name = 0 + column = 0 + jsLine = 1 + lines: seq[Line] + +for gline in data.mappings.split(';'): + jsLine += 1 + var jsColumn = 0 + for item in gline.strip().split(','): + let value = item.decodeVLQ() + doAssert value.len in [0, 1, 4, 5] + if value.len == 0: + continue + jsColumn += value[0] + if value.len >= 4: + source += value[1] + line += value[2] + column += value[3] + lines &= Line(line: line, column: column, file: data.sources[source]) + +let jsLines = jsFile.splitLines().len +# There needs to be a mapping for every line in the JS +# If there isn't then the JS lines wont match up with Nim lines. +# Except we don't care about the final line since that doesn't need to line up +doAssert data.mappings.count(';') == jsLines - 1 + +# Check we can find this file somewhere in the source map +var foundSelf = false +for line in lines: + if "tsourcemap.nim" in line.file: + foundSelf = true + doAssert line.line in 0..<jsLines, "Lines is out of bounds for file" +doAssert foundSelf, "Couldn't find tsourcemap.nim in source map" |
